The moment we walked into the display home at Pacific Cove we absolutely loved the house loved the raked ceilings and loved the feeling of space. Andrew was so easy to deal with, he didnt try to pressure us into unnecessary changes.
During the build process Kristie was amazing!! Any issues we had were only minor and these were sorted promptly. We only lived 5 minutes from the house so we visited often to check progress. I can honestly say it felt like eternity (haha mostly because we couldnt wait till it was finished). The house was actually finished before the contract date so it shows that it ran on time.
We have now moved into our amazing home, one week later we are trying to find things wrong but can say the workmanship is to a high quality. We are so happy that we were able to take advantage of the fixed costs there were no hidden costs like some of the nightmare reviews I had read.
Overall it has been a stress free build would highly recommend Tony and the team.at Visual Diversity.

We are a young married couple who made the bold decision to build our first home and overall it was one of the most stressful things I've ever done BUT the stress had nothing to do with Visual Diversity, in fact building with them is the best decision we ever made. We initially met Tony in the Durack display where our new home was being built and when we initially told him what we wanted to spend and what the home we wanted to build would cost through them, they were too expensive but in spite of this he then spent the next 2 hours with us explaining who would be best in our price range and what to look out for. After getting several other quotes and doing a lot more research we decided to increase the amount we wanted to spend and go with Visual as several other builders were offering less complete houses for up to 40k more.
Upon signing the pre lim process was easy, Rachael is amazing at what she does and always got back to me whenever we had questions and she was the one always driving us to get paper work back to speed the process up. But the thing that has impressed me the most is that they were always true to the word from day 1 and told us that as long as we communicated openly with them, they would work with us and they demonstrates this over and over. After we signed up if we ever needed to speak with Tony, we could always make a time to see him. When our finance nearly fell through due to an incompetent broker and bank there was no pressure from Visual and instead as soon as we told them what was going on Tony called me 20 mins later saying that if we desperately needed a new lender he had a contact with his bank who could meet us the next day if we needed it.
When the contract nearly fell through again at settlement we had exactly the same response. Communication throughout the build was also great, 99% of the time I got responses back within minutes or hours of sending questions through. My wife and I also ended being overseas at handover and once again Visual worked with us and Tony did the handover with our parents even after the office had technically closed over Christmas. Now that we are back from overseas and the office has re opened we have already arranged for the few minor defects to be attended to only days after contacting them. If you want to view the quality of the houses there are about 5 houses either recently finished or being built by Visual on our street
and when we spoke to our neighbour who had also just finished building with Visual he had nothing but praise for them as well. So in summary yes I am a real customer of visual, I think the negative comments on this wall are from their competitors because I just do not understand how their experience could be that bad considering how good ours and our neighbours experience of them was
and if we were ever going to build again they would be our first choice.

April 2017 nearly!!
Too many excuses non existent customer service.
All happy to help at the start get you in the door feed you anything you want and need.
Until the minute you are locked in and then you're handed over to Admin staff his wife who take weeks to reply the builder/owner [name removed] will ring you and he NEVER does! Won't give you contact for supervisor which we didn't even get one till a year into our build have to speak to admin girls who never know what you are talking about when you call with a problem. It took 8 months to get an onsite meeting with owner and that was the month our house was meant to be finished and it was no way near finished and now 6 months later still not in.
15 months waiting for our home and still not in.
Seriously had been very stressful
House meant to be finished Dec 2016
Now march 21st 2017 and our house is NOT completed. ( UPDATE moved in May)
So disappointed is an understatement feel awful bagging people but this had to be said I hope no one goes through what we have with them I wish I read these reviews before we signed.
Moved in then the next day our oven was installed!!??? Gas and phone lines were completed so had no gas hot water oven phonelines when we moved in. Oven was faulty and day 5 living there with no oven as it is faulty visual diversity take no responsibility for this nor do their suppler reece electrical who installed the oven! Hops been repaired day 3 of moving but still with an oven that doesn't even work after all the stress and drama this is just the icing on the cake. So disappointed and sad it's hasn't been worth the tears and stress this build.
Only plus side is I do love the floor plan of our home. Very substandard workmanship of house cheaps and poor job.

We love that Visual Diversity have the solid concrete slab and steel frame. It makes the house feel safer, and is a more solid foundation. We opted for a large door and hallway, raked ceiling and ducted air conditioning, the home feels open and spacious, and we get many comments on how beautiful our home is.
The Visual Diversity team were always prompt in returning correspondence and answering any questions, especially Andrew, who was very reassuring.
Tony offered genuine advice and was very thorough with the defect walkthrough, and made certain that any issues were resolved promptly, so that we could move in early, as we had to move out of a rental property by a certain deadline.
We have been in our home for about 6 months now, very few defects were found after moving in, this included the back sliding doors sticking, the knobs on the oven were reversed and our caesar-stone bench top not being sealed down. All of the above issues were resolved within days of being reported.
We plan on living in our home for many years to come, but if we were to ever build again, I would be more than happy to choose Visual Diversity.

This company should be avoided at all costs, as don't be fooled by the cheap price, it's because they will give you a poor quality home. The attitude of the builders and their staff is nothing short of disgraceful.
The builder constantly ignored my emails or phone contacts regarding inferior work, to which they still haven't fixed. Every trade supplied inferior work, such as plumbing drains blocking, timber frame work not installed properly, large gaps between finished render work and the windows, so bad that you can actually see through into the timber frame.
I would not recommend this company to build anything. They will ignore all correspondence and when they do happen to reply to my emails, they supply an arrogant attitude. They seem to enjoy being at war with clients and contractors. Not a very good business plan. Do yourself a favour and avoid this builder at all costs, you will be better served not having to be treated with total disrespect and arrogance.
Disgraceful attitude to the client, poor build quality, poor contractors.
